    Video of first test P Open Sport Hydro. Boat is not right yet but good. The entrance to tunnel is too low and causes some problems. that is what a test mule is all about. Now I can make changes to the mold and have a real winner.

                          I set up this boat to have the batteries in the sponsons with out hatches. I also built the hatch extra heavy so it can not flex and pop off. I will have the first test runs this weekend. I just need to see how much flotation it takes to float 8.8 pounds.

                              I ran the boat this weekend. It had only been ran once in open water that morning. I did not get a start first heat race out of sequence set up on Swordfish. The next three heats I got first place and win the class for the day. I can slide up to 5000Mah 4S packs in each side and I put a thin piece of foam to hold in place. works nice I have a little dial in to do but the new mold is all most flaw less. The molds are for testing and still not the final molds for production, but much better than the first test mold.
